HOST: And what are some current trends in this area of sustainable architecture? GUEST: There's growing interest in biophilic design, which brings elements of nature into built environments. Also, digital fabrication technologies are making it easier to replicate complex geometries found in nature. HOST: Those sound like exciting developments. But there must be challenges too. What would you say is the biggest hurdle in implementing biomimetic strategies? GUEST: One challenge is changing the mindset of traditional construction industries. We need to promote the long-term benefits of these innovative solutions over short-term cost savings. HOST: That makes sense. Looking forward, where do you see the future of bio-inspired structures? GUEST: I believe we'll see increased adoption as climate change becomes more pressing. As architects and engineers, we have a responsibility to reduce our carbon footprint, and bio-inspired design offers a promising path.
